    While they also mention Serbs, most of these texts mention more Albanians than Serbs including the people who greeted the Austrian army in Prizren yet they claim they were replaced by Albanians after 1690 The Bulk of the 20,000 were mostly Albanian who Bogdani had vouched for.

    There were also various disagreements with the leaders of the Arnauts whom the Duke ordered to give up their weapons and disband their militia and to pay tribute to the Germans, as the peasants did. This was an intolerable insult to this free and martial nation.

    It even describes the Austrians having argument with one Albanian.


    You can get the document name: Extract from Annotationes und Reflexiones der gloriosen kayserlichen Waffen im Jahr 1689. in: Austrian State Archives (Österreichisches Staatsarchiv), Military Archives (Kriegsarchiv), Vienna, AFA, Carton 195, 1689-13-1, fol. 32r-49r. Translated from the German by Robert Elsie.]

    Even the Irish/British historian MacShane says it was Pjeter Bogdani and not Arsenije Crnojevic

    The Albanian Catholic Archbishop Pjeter Bogdani was trained in Rome and wrote the first great literary work in Albanian, Band of Prophets, in the late 17th century. He tried to organize a rebellion against Turkish rule in Kosovo in which he lost his life in 1689.
    Why Kosovo Matters - MacShane
